How much do program coordinator int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for program coordinator intern in Townsend, DE is $20.82,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$25.43 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a program coordinator intern do?

A Program Coordinator Intern assists with organizing, planning, and executing various programs or projects within an organization. Their responsibilities often include scheduling meetings, coordinating activities, maintaining records, and communicating with team members or stakeholders. This internship provides valuable experience in project management, team collaboration, and problem-solving. Interns also gain exposure to the operational side of program management and may contribute to program evaluation and reporting.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a program coordinator int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Program Coordinator Intern, you typically need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in project management or a related field. Familiarity with project management software (such as Trello or Asana), Microsoft Office Suite, and sometimes event planning tools is often required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and adaptability help you manage multiple tasks and collaborate effectively with diverse stakeholders. These skills and qualities are crucial for efficiently supporting program logistics, ensuring smooth operations, and contributing to overall project success.

How to get experience as a program coordinator intern?

To gain experience as a program coordinator intern, seek internships or volunteer opportunities in organizations that manage projects or community programs. Developing skills in project management, communication, and organization, along with familiarity with tools like Microsoft Office or project management software, can enhance your qualifications. Relevant coursework or certifications in project management can also improve your chances of securing an internship in this role.

Job Overview
A Bachelor's Level Intern at Acenda Integrated Health's Family Success Center supports community engagement initiatives by assisting with outreach, marketing, and event planning to promote programs and services. This role provides hands-on experience in community-based services while helping connect individuals and families with valuable resources through education, advocacy, and relationship-building.
As an integrated health organization Acenda values the use of evidence-based practice or EBP's.
Program Info
Acenda's Family Success Centers (FSC) are warm, welcoming neighborhood gathering spaces where families and community members come together for support, connection, and growth. FSC's offer interactive workshops, family-friendly activities, and groups, as well as volunteer opportunities. All services are free and open to all. Additionally, the FSC's offer free computer use, printing, and copying services.
